在 Keepass 触发器中使用 Entry 的文件附件

在 Keepass 触发器中使用 Entry 的文件附件

我想创建一个触发器来复制我的一个条目的文件附件,并在 KeePass2.x DB 打开时将其复制到磁盘

触发手册说:触发字段可以使用指向数据字段引用

字段参考手册解释了检索“密码”“我的参赛作品”':
{REF:P@T:my entry}

我希望能够做类似的事情:
文件%comspec%
争论/c copy {REF:F:my_file.txt@T:My Entry title} C:\destination

答案1

KeePass 团队告诉我,这可以通过 KPScript 文件完成,但你需要了解 C++ 和 KeePass 内部原理

所以我最终要做的是创建一个新条目,其中包含文件内容Notes和目标路径URL,我的触发器是
文件:powershell.exe
参数:

-Command "Set-Content '{REF:A@I:4EADD152156165924CD9246A651D}' '{REF:N@I:4EADDB3BD09E0456416514CD9246A651D}'"

相关内容